Scoring tool for legibility of prescriptions

Score Standard Meaning
0 Clear Standard of clarity is such that the prescription can easily be read and interpreted, and acted on with confidence
1 Some difficulty with clarity Standard of clarity is such that there is difficulty in reading and/or interpreting one or more parts of the prescription and there is a possibility of misinterpretation.
2 Unclear Standard of clarity is such that the one or more parts of instructions/meaning cannot be fully discerned and the prescription cannot be acted on with confidence.
